J110G stuck on ODIN MODE


in odin mode say:
ODIN MODE(multi core download)

try flashing but sending sboot.bin timmeout

Operation: Flash
Selected model: SM-J110G
Software version: 26.1

File analysis... OK
Total file size: 0x3FBD8530 (1019 Mb)
Searching USB Flash Interface... detected COM5
Setup connection... OK
Set PIT file... OK
Reading PIT from phone... OK
Sending Sboot.bin... error timeout

Done with Samsung Tool PRO v.26.1
